Description

Visit Reunion Towers' GeO-Deck and you’ll experience breathtaking 360-degree panoramic views and an indoor/outdoor observation deck that lets you see for miles in any direction. From 470 feet up, you’ll experience the city from an entirely new view. Day or night, make the iconic Reunion Tower your first stop to explore fun things to see and do in Dallas. Please note that dining is not currently available at Reunion Tower and access to the restaurant levels is not included with this ticket.

Itinerary

Admission included

As part of the ticket price, you will receive a free digital photo. A Reunion Tower Ambassador will take a photo of you at the bottom of the tower, and by the time you reach the top, you can share it with the world. You can view your image at the photo kiosk, choose a background, share it through email or social media, and personalize keepsakes to take home. Continue your journey 470 feet in the air to the GeO-Deck. This indoor/outdoor observation deck lets you explore the city unlike anywhere else. Step up to the interactive touch screen and with just one swipe, you’ll be able to discover local hidden gems, historic landmarks, museums, parks, and more. Ready for a different view? Head outside for a lap around the exterior deck and feel the wind in your hair as you stand 470 feet in the air! Take a look through one of the high-definition zoom cameras and you’ll be able to see for miles in any direction.

View of the city

I passed by this place for at least the past few two years thinking someday I will finally go and so I did. It was an easy purchase online through Tripadvisor. It can also be purchased on Viator and other sizes well for the price around $25. I thought it was a decent price for a short outing for the day. The tour last anywhere from one to two hours long. There was not a long wait in line. You’re greeted at the ticket booth, which is located in The Hyatt Regency. You can also purchase your tickets there as well . Once you’re scanned in there is a green screen in the background. You can take photos prior to going up to the deco. They also have a gift shop with little trinkets you can purchase from T-shirts, keychains, magnets, and even a few snacks before or after the viewing. They will take you up on the elevator and of course not even thinking you will see much on the elevator. There appears the beautiful sunshine and land as far as it stretches appear. It was amazing! If you have an issue with vertigo or heights, you could possibly become nauseated from the motion of going up. It wasn’t too terrible, but we made it to the top and of course our ears were popping, but that was a quick easy fix by swallowing. the view were breathtaking. The breeze was fabulous on a hot summer day. There was a minimal crowd there mainly middle age, and a few children. There were multiple halos around where you can read information obout different landmarks throughout the city. Once you’re done viewing, you can purchase some food or drinks. They have ice cream, drinks, things of that nature to purchase. You can get some great pictures from up there. I highly recommend this tour if you’re looking for a day out around downtown Dallas. Great for soloing, groups and couples. I would recommend visiting during the evening hours.

Nice way to spend 2 hours - hope to go back at night!

On a whim, I took my 8- and 11-year-old to Reunion Tower since we were in the downtown area for an errand. We've lived in the metroplex for a while and had never been. So glad we did! Visiting the Tower today made me proud to be a Texan! Our experience at Reunion was excellent! Everything felt clean and modern. The employees were very friendly – especially Sydney on the elevator, who had a beautiful smile and persona, told us some quick facts on the 60-second ride up and down, and DonaMarie on the Geo-Deck. DonaMarie was enthusiastic to show my girls how to do the Scavenger Hunt, as well as where to look for clues, etc., and even reassured them that she would help fill in any blanks they missed - which she did! She sat down with them and answered all the ones they couldn't find in the time we were there. Donamarie genuinely seemed to enjoy her job, taking interest in wanting to help the visitors. It's rare these days that an employee will go out of their way with knowledge and friendliness to "go the extra mile" for a customer - she did both! The views are incredible with lots of ways to see landmarks, and there is a nice tribute to JFK as well (you can't miss Dealey Plaza from the Tower... can even see the "x" on the street where he was shot). The icing on the cake was finding out that with the price of our tickets, we received a digital copy of the pictures they took of us at the beginning of the tour - such a nice surprise to be able to leave with this kind of souvenir (DonaMarie helped me with this as well)!
